The Wayne County Sheriff’s Office reports the arrest of an Ontario woman following an investigation into a traffic stop that occurred in the Town of Williamson.

Deputies arrested Debra J. Thomas-Bradley, 29, of Ridge Road, Ontario for 1 Count of Failure to Keep Right, 1 Count of Driving on the Shoulder, 1 Count of DWI Common Law, 1 Count of DWI .08% BAC or greater, 1 Count of possession of an open container of alcohol in a motor vehicle, 1 Count of Failure to notify DMV of an address change to driver’s license and 1 Count of Driving while Operating a Mobile Device.

The charges stem from an investigation into a traffic stop in the Town of Williamson where it is alleged that Thomas-Bradley was operating a vehicle eastbound on State Route 104 erratically failing to keep right swerving into the median and shoulder multiple times.  Thomas-Bradley was asked to participate in standardized field sobriety testing which she agreed to and failed said standardized field sobriety testing leading to her arrest.

Thomas-Bradley was then transported to the Wayne County Sheriff’s Office where she submitted to a chemical test yielding a .16 % BAC.  Thomas-Bradley was then transported to the Wayne County Jail for processing before being released on tickets.

Thomas-Bradley is to appear in the Town of Williamson Court at a later date to answer to the charges.
